STEAM into the library in May!

Coming in May, we are excited to have the UW Extension bringing in STEAM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Art and Mathematics) programs to the After School Program at the library every Tuesday until the end of the school year!

Starting on May 9 with "From Playdough to Plato" where the participants wil build structures using toothpicks and playdough, then on March 16, we'll learn about "Wind Energy and Paper Pinwheels", to learn how wind energy works.

May 23 brings "Seed Ball" Fun, participants will create a seed ball for their garden, then create a picture using seeds, beans, and legumes!

Finally, on May 30, experience "Jelly Making 101" - we'll make jelly from start to finish, then enjoy a taste with crackers!

All students are welcome!
